Big 12 foes match up when the No. 3 Texas Longhorns (3-0) and the Baylor Bears (1-2) play on Saturday, September 23, 2023 at McLane Stadium.

Texas ranks 55th in total offense this year (409.3 yards per game), but has been thriving on the other side of the ball, ranking 22nd-best in the FBS with 409.3 yards allowed per game. Baylor ranks 51st with 418 total yards per game on offense, and it ranks 58th with 333.7 total yards ceded per game on defense.

Texas Stats Leaders

  • Quinn Ewers has 740 passing yards for Texas, completing 60.7% of his passes and tossing eight touchdowns this season.
  • Jonathon Brooks has racked up 273 yards on 47 carries while finding paydirt one time. He's also caught three passes for 46 yards (15.3 per game) and one touchdown through the air.
  • CJ Baxter has racked up 69 yards on 16 carries.
  • Xavier Worthy's 221 yards as a receiver lead the team. He's been targeted 26 times and has totaled 16 catches and two touchdowns.
  • Ja'Tavion Sanders has caught seven passes for 158 yards (52.7 yards per game) and one touchdown this year.
  • Adonai Mitchell has compiled nine grabs for 134 yards, an average of 44.7 yards per game. He's scored three times as a receiver this season.

Baylor Stats Leaders

  • Sawyer Robertson has recored 444 passing yards, or 148 per game, so far this season. He has completed 45.2% of his passes and has tossed one touchdown with three interceptions. He's also helped out on the ground with 15.7 rushing yards per game while scoring as a runner one time.
  • Dominic Richardson is his team's leading rusher with 30 carries for 156 yards, or 52 per game.
  • Richard Reese has run for 117 yards across 26 carries, scoring two touchdowns.
  • Ketron Jackson Jr. has racked up 168 receiving yards on 10 receptions to pace his squad so far this season.
  • Hal Presley has put up a 155-yard season so far. He's caught eight passes on 16 targets.
  • Drake Dabney's eight receptions (on 13 targets) have netted him 139 yards (46.3 ypg) and three touchdowns.
